Disabled railway workers got relief

Lucknow. In the capital Lucknow, three-wheeler scooters were distributed to the disabled employees working in Lucknow Division of North Eastern Railway to easily reach their workplace. General Manager North Eastern Railway Uday Boranvarkar presented scooties to 23 disabled employees of Lucknow Division. It was told that about two months ago, scooters were distributed to 13 disabled employees of the division. After this, on the demand of NE Railway Men's Congress, the General Manager agreed to the proposal of providing scooties to the remaining disabled employees in the division.

Divisional Railway Manager Lucknow Gaurav Agarwal, Senior Divisional Personnel Officer Rajesh Kumar Gupta, Divisional Minister of NE Railway Men's Congress Rakesh Chandra Verma, Divisional Minister of OBC Association Sanjay Yadav and Divisional Minister of SC-ST Association Navneet Verma played an important role in allocating funds for distribution of scooters from the Employees Welfare Fund.
